Description

Buy2Let Investment - We are delighted to offer this light and spacious split level first floor apartment set only a short walk to Norwich train station and the city centre. Currently tenanted with gross income of £8340 per annum.

In brief, the property comprises; lounge, kitchen, double bedroom and a main bathroom.  

ENTRANCE HALL Accessed via stairs from communal corridor, further doors to lounge, bedroom and kitchen and floor laid to carpet.  

KITCHEN 8' 8" x 11' 0" (2.65m x 3.37m) Modernised space comprising a range of wall and base units with composite work tops, integrated double electric oven with gas hob and extractor hood over, integrated fridge - freezer, space and plumbing for washing machine, uPVC double glazed window to the front aspect, inset composite sink with mixer tap and drainer, tiled splash back, double glazed casement window to the side aspect, radiator, wall mounted gas boiler in cupboard and Karndean flooring.  

LOUNGE 11' 11" x 11' 1" (3.65m x 3.39m) UP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, double glazed casement window to the side aspect, floor laid to carpet and a radiator. Door to:  

BATHROOM 7' 2" x 5' 8" (2.20m x 1.73m) Large walk in shower with tiled backing and sliding door, low set WC, pedestal hand wash basin with tiled splash back, heated towel rail, laminate flooring, extractor fan and an obscure uP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ect.  

BEDROOM 13' 8" x 10' 2" (4.19m x 3.12m) Double bedroom with two double glazed casement windows to the side aspect, velux window, eaves storage, radiator and floor laid to carpet.  

LEASE The property comes with a 50% share of the freehold of the building. There are no service charges or ground rent and it runs 125 years from 2006. The lease has also recently been amended to allow for holiday let usage. 

COUNCIL TAX The property comes under Norwich City Council and is in tax band A.  

SERVICES Gas, Electricity, Water and drainage are connected to the property, Websters have not tested these services.
